TinyURL: The Classic and Simple Choice

TinyURL is one of the oldest and most recognized names in the URL shortening game. Its strength lies in its simplicity and accessibility. If you need a quick, no-fuss way to shorten a URL, TinyURL is often the go-to.

Pros of TinyURL:

  • Simplicity: Its interface is incredibly straightforward. You paste your long URL, click a button, and get a short one. There's no learning curve.
  • Free for Basic Use: For individual use and casual sharing, TinyURL offers a completely free service.
  • No Account Required: You don't need to create an account to generate a short URL, making it ideal for one-off tasks.
  • Custom Alias Option (Limited): TinyURL allows you to create a custom alias for your shortened URL, which is great for branding or making the link more memorable. For example, you could turn a long URL into `tinyurl.com/YourBrandName`.
  • Link Persistence: Links generated by TinyURL are designed to be permanent, meaning they won't expire unless the original content is removed from the web.

Cons of TinyURL:

  • Limited Analytics: TinyURL offers very basic tracking. You can't get detailed insights into how many people clicked your link, where they came from, or on which devices. This makes it less suitable for marketing campaigns that require performance data.
  • Basic Customization: While it offers custom aliases, it lacks advanced branding options like custom domains.
  • Potential for Spam Association: Due to its widespread use and the ease with which anyone can create links, some users or spam filters might be wary of TinyURL links, especially if they lead to unsolicited content.
  • No Advanced Features: Forget about features like link expiry, password protection, or detailed targeting.

When to Use TinyURL:

TinyURL is perfect for:

  • Personal Sharing: Sending links to friends and family.
  • Quick Social Media Posts: When you need to share a link on platforms where character limits are a concern, and detailed analytics aren't a priority.
  • Internal Communications: Sharing links within a team or organization where advanced tracking isn't necessary.
  • Creating Memorable Links: If you need a short, custom-named link for a presentation or a speech.

Bitly: The Marketing and Analytics Powerhouse

Bitly has established itself as a leading url shortener with analytics, especially for businesses and marketers. It goes beyond simple link shortening to provide valuable data and tools for tracking campaign performance.

Pros of Bitly:

  • Robust Analytics: This is Bitly's standout feature. You can track click-through rates, geographic data of your audience, top referrers, and device information. This data is invaluable for optimizing marketing efforts.
  • Customizable Links: Bitly allows for custom branded links (e.g., `bit.ly/YourBrand`) even on its free tier, enhancing brand recognition. Paid plans offer even more advanced customization, including custom subdomains.
  • Link Management: You can organize your shortened links into groups, making it easier to manage multiple campaigns.
  • Integration Capabilities: Bitly integrates with various marketing and social media management tools, streamlining your workflow.
  • QR Code Generation: Some Bitly plans include QR code generation, allowing you to easily bridge the physical and digital worlds.
  • Campaign Tracking: You can tag links to specific campaigns, making it easier to attribute traffic and conversions.

Cons of Bitly:

  • Free Tier Limitations: While Bitly offers a free tier, it has limits on the number of links you can create per month and the depth of analytics available. For extensive use or advanced features, a paid subscription is necessary.
  • Account Required: To utilize most of Bitly's features, including custom links and analytics, you'll need to create an account.
  • Steeper Learning Curve: Compared to TinyURL, Bitly has a more complex interface due to its extensive features.
  • Link Expiry on Free Tier (Sometimes): While Bitly's core links are generally persistent, some promotional or experimental features on the free tier might have expiry considerations, though this is less common for standard shortening.

When to Use Bitly:

Bitly is an excellent choice for:

  • Marketing Campaigns: Tracking the effectiveness of your social media, email marketing, and advertising efforts.
  • Social Media Management: Understanding which posts drive the most traffic.
  • Influencer Marketing: Providing trackable links to influencers.
  • Content Creators: Analyzing audience engagement with shared links.
  • Businesses: Maintaining brand consistency with custom short links.

For robust tracking and brand control, Bitly is a strong contender. If you're looking to understand your audience better, Bitly's analytics are invaluable. You might also find it useful to generate QR codes for your shortened links, which Bitly can facilitate on certain plans.

Choosing the Right URL Shortener for Your Needs

The "best" URL shortener is subjective and depends entirely on your use case. Here's a more nuanced look at how to make your decision:

For the Casual User or Quick Share: TinyURL or FYN Tools

If you just need to shorten a long URL for an email to a friend, a quick tweet, or a forum post, and you don't need to track anything, both TinyURL and FYN Tools are excellent choices. Their ease of use and no-account-needed policy make them incredibly convenient for one-off tasks. FYN Tools edges out TinyURL here if you also want to generate a QR code simultaneously.

For Marketers and Businesses Needing Insights: Bitly

If you're running marketing campaigns, managing social media for a brand, or need to understand how your links are performing, Bitly is the undisputed leader. The detailed analytics allow you to measure ROI, optimize your strategy, and make data-driven decisions. While the free tier is a good starting point, you'll likely need a paid plan for serious marketing efforts. For developers who need to integrate short links into applications, Bitly also offers robust APIs.
